Machine List

Purpose

Use the machine list to view, create, and manage machines that appear across dashboards, analyses, exports, and AI predictions.

Machines are global objects: once a machine is created, it can be used across the system (subject to permissions).

Steps (create a machine)

  1. Open Settings > Machines.
  2. Select Add machine.
  3. Enter a Machine name.
  4. Optional: add a machine image.
  5. Select Save.

Steps (edit a machine)

  1. Open Settings > Machines.
  2. Select a machine from the list.
  3. Update the name and/or image.
  4. Select Save.

Steps (delete a machine)

  1. Open Settings > Machines.
  2. Select the machine.
  3. Select Delete (trash icon).
  4. Confirm the deletion.

Deleting a machine removes it from machine-specific views and analyses. Only do this if the machine is permanently decommissioned.

Best practices

  • Use a consistent naming scheme (line/station naming) so search and dashboards stay predictable.
  • Add images only if they help operators select the correct machine quickly.
  • Avoid deleting machines unless you are sure they are no longer used anywhere.

Troubleshooting

  • You cannot add or edit machines -> Missing permission -> Ask an admin to update your role -> Escalate to support if you cannot identify the correct role
  • A machine is missing -> Search filter active or machine not configured -> Clear filters and re-check -> Ask an admin to confirm the machine exists in Settings
